AGRA: The Mainpuri police , on Saturday, arrested three men, after a brief encounter, for allegedly smuggling 605 boxes of Indian made foreign liquor (IMFL) worth Rs 20 lakhs from Haryana. However, their three associates managed to escape.According to the police, acting on a tip off, a team was formed to arrest the smugglers. Around 6 am, when police officers signalled the suspected vehicles to stop at Oncha road, the suspects started firing on the police personnel.After a brief exchange of fire, the police managed to arrest three of the suspects, Rajesh Yadav Prabal Prakash , and Pavan Yadav. Those who escaped were identified as Surendra Yadav, Rakesh Yadav, and Sonu.Talking to TOI, Senior Superintendent of Police (SSP) Ajay Shankar Rai said that they all have been booked on the charges of smuggling liquor, forgery, and attempt to murder under relevant sections of IPC and Excise Act.SSP told TOI that two of the absconding suspects including Sonu and Surendra Yadav are also wanted under Gangster Act. He said, they will be arrested soon. Police also seized three vehicles including a Scorpio.According to officials the police has been told to crackdown on liquor smuggling and in the recent past there have been several such seizures.On June 4, Firozabad police had recovered 442 cartons of IMFL worth Rs 27 lakh and arrested three men in this regard. Similarly, on April 18, Indian made foreign liquor (IMFL) worth Rs 48.24 lakh was seized and two men were arrested and on April 10 night, Firozabad police had seized 550 cartons of IMFL worth Rs 16 lakh, which had been smuggled from Haryana.Besides, in two separate raids, Etah and Mathura police , along with the excise department had seized 718 cartons of illegal IMFL and country-made liquor as well as 605 cartons of country-made liquor from Rajasthan registered truck and a Lucknow-registered SUV respectively on March 23.
